LaGrange County Tied for Lowest Jobless Rate in the State; Other Area Counties Also Down In October
Friday, November 26, 2021

INDIANAPOLIS, IN – Unemployment rates around Northeast Indiana went down from September to October.

According to the Indiana Department of Workforce Development, Steuben County went down one-tenth of a percent from 1.9 to 1.8.

LaGrange County had no change in their jobless rate, staying at 1.5 percent. That ties them with Union County for the lowest jobless rate in the Hoosier State.

The biggest drops in Northeast Indiana were in Noble and DeKalb Counties, which both went down three-tenths of a percent. Noble County dropped from 2.6 to 2.3 percent, while DeKalb County went from 2.2 to 1.9 percent.
